Deploy step 4 — fan-out backpressure (Hollowpine Notify). Set queue depth cap to 50k before rollout. If the Skerry dispatcher lags, shed low-priority pushes first; never drop transactional. Watch the backpressure gauge for ten minutes post-deploy. Rollback is one flag flip. The release artifact must be signed before the dispatcher accepts it; use the key below.

deploy key for yajeg-hahog: bky3_BZq

Action item: the Marwick queue-depth autoscaler scaled down too aggressively after the backlog cleared, causing a second spike. Add a cooldown window and a minimum-replica floor before the next deploy. As the new contractor on this, you own the config change; the autoscaler's tuning parameters and test harness are described on the internal page below.

operations page: https://jira.qorvelsys.internal/browse/pages/browse/pages

# WebSocket compression settings for the Fernwick relay.
# We enable permessage-deflate only for payloads over 2 KB: smaller
# frames cost more CPU than the bandwidth saved, and our telemetry
# showed latency spikes when compressing everything. If you raise the
# threshold, watch memory on the edge nodes — each context holds a
# sliding window. Metrics are persisted to the tuning database, which
# is reached via the connection string below.

replica DSN, kajep-yahag: mssql://praok_svc:iF@db-8d68.plorvaio.local:5432/eliion

Ticket: Configuration drift on Tollwright rules engine — plugin authors please read. We discovered that three regional evaluation nodes in the Merrowvale cluster were running with settings that diverged from the declared baseline, causing plugin-supplied fee rules to evaluate against a stale currency-rounding mode. If your plugin's integration tests pass locally but fail in staging, this drift is the likely cause. To help you reproduce, the corrected canonical baseline we have now enforced everywhere is listed below.

settings of fafog-haduf:
ZORIX_PIN=4648
ZORIX_METRICS_HOST=metrics.zorix.paliqsys.corp
ZORIX_LOG_LEVEL=info
ZORIX_TENANT=druix